Output f3314c3d0116c20a2142b29b9cb0876fc325b04d133f60288a8de7e2e90eabea:2

value
149191726
script pubkey
OP_0 OP_PUSHBYTES_20 767950e776f4d6aab9915a2260a3af23538798f3
address
bc1qweu4pemk7nt24wv3tg3xpga0ydfc0x8n082sz8
transaction
f3314c3d0116c20a2142b29b9cb0876fc325b04d133f60288a8de7e2e90eabea
spent
true